Implement Seasonal Rotation

Organizing your coat closet isn’t just about using clear bins; it’s also about making sure everything is easy to reach throughout the year. To achieve this, implement a seasonal rotation schedule.

Start by designating a specific time for your seasonal swap—perhaps at the beginning of each season. As you switch out items, take a moment to assess what you truly need and what can be donated. This way, you’ll maintain a clutter-free space that reflects your current wardrobe needs.

Keep frequently used items at eye level, ensuring easy access. Your coat closet won’t only look tidy but will also serve you better season after season, making your daily routine smoother and more enjoyable!

Designate Specific Zones

While it might seem overwhelming at first, creating specific zones in your coat closet can transform chaos into calm. By focusing on zone allocation and area designation, you’ll enhance clutter control through functional grouping.

Think of your spatial arrangement as a way to invite ease into your daily routine.

  • Outerwear Zone: Keep jackets and coats front and center.
  • Accessory Zone: Hang scarves, gloves, and hats in easy reach.
  • Footwear Zone: Use bins or shelves for shoes, keeping pairs together.
  • Storage Zone: Tuck away out-of-season items neatly.

With an efficient layout and purposeful spaces, you’ll find item categorization becomes second nature.
